From Technician to Leader: ITSM Career Growth Strategies

Transitioning from a technician role as the realm of IT Service Management (ITSM) leadership can be a challenging journey. Utilizing your technical foundation while honing essential leadership skills is key to navigating this trajectory.

At the outset, prioritize formal training programs and certifications that support your ITSM knowledge base. Learn industry best practices like ITIL, COBIT, and ISO/IEC 20000. Connecting with skilled ITSM professionals can provide invaluable guidance.

Proactively participate in industry events, join professional organizations, and network with peers to broaden your network.

  • Highlight strong communication, problem-solving, and decision-making skills.
  • Pursue opportunities to lead projects and teams, showcasing your directive abilities.
  • Be updated on emerging ITSM trends and technologies through continuous learning.

Remember, dedication and a willingness to learn are crucial for attaining your ITSM leadership goals. By thoughtfully refining your skills and expanding your network, you can competently progress from a technician to a respected leader in the ITSM field.

Begin your Building Your Success Story: A Roadmap for IT Service Management Careers

A career in IT Service Management holds a wealth of prospects for individuals passionate about technology and clientele satisfaction. Formulating a successful journey within this dynamic field involves a well-defined roadmap, one that directs you through the intricacies of service delivery and promotes essential skills.

Start by identifying your talents and associating them with specific roles within IT Service Management. Prominent paths encompass service desk analyst, support engineer, incident manager, and change manager, each bringing a unique angle to the overall service lifecycle.

  • Obtain industry-recognized endorsements.
  • Enhance your technical skills in areas such as help desk tools, ticketing systems, and IT infrastructure management.
  • Socialize with other professionals in the field through online forums to build your knowledge and build valuable connections.

Incessant learning is crucial in IT Service Management. Stay knowledgeable with the latest trends, technologies, and best practices through workshops.
